Package: gcc-snapshot Version: 1:20200124-1 Severity: normal One has:
-rw-r--r-- 1 198M 2019-11-30 15:28:32 gcc-snapshot_1%3a20191130-1_amd64.deb -rw-r--r-- 1 567M 2020-01-24 23:43:53 gcc-snapshot_1%3a20200124-1_amd64.deb and Package: gcc-snapshot Version: 1:20191130-1 Installed-Size: 1066234 Package: gcc-snapshot Version: 1:20200124-1 Installed-Size: 3067842 So both the .deb size and the install size have almost tripled! According to a diff, this is apparently due to some executables from /usr/lib/gcc-snapshot/libexec/gcc/x86_64-linux-gnu/10, which now have debug info and are no longer stripped, making them 10 times as big.
